Important Information
After replacing your BCM (Body Control Module), important steps must be taken to ensure proper functionality:
Resetting the Airbag Warning Light: Perform the ‘Setup SDM Primary Key in BCM’ procedure using a qualified diagnostic tool to reset the airbag warning light.
Brake Pedal Recalibration: Some vehicles may require a brake pedal recalibration after BCM replacement. This ensures optimal braking performance and safety.
Note: The specific steps may vary depending on your vehicle, so it is advisable to consult your vehicle’s manual or seek assistance from a professional technician if you are unsure about any procedure.
